What is the job market for LPNs and RNs like, and how much money will I make?

0

We are projected to experience a nursing shortage within the next 10-15 years, as many nurses retire. In southeast Kansas, LPNs are paid $12-14 per hour. RNs in SEK earn 18-20 per hour as a beginning wage. These wages are low compared to what can be earned in area cities such as Joplin, Tulsa, and Wichita. As the nationwide nursing shortage evolves, an increase in pay will accompany the trend. The average age of an RN in the U.S. is 46 and 50% will be retiring within the next 20 years. Even more critical is the current and projected shortage of nurse educators.
